Peterboro, NY – The Madison County Coonhunters Association of Peterboro, New York hosted a Pro-A Series ev ent on Friday, September 7th. Rich Taber submitted the following report:

Submitted by Rich Taber of the Madison County Coonhunters Association

On Friday night sixteen dogs battled for a win in the rolling hills of Upstate Central New York, in our first ever $2000 Pro-am hunt. Hunting out of Peterboro, in the heart and geographic center of the Empire State, resulted in the following scores:

First round scores:

Tiny, a Treeing Walker male owned by Larry Proulx and Big Jim Auxier, and handled by Jim. 200+

T, a Treeing Walker male owned and handled by Alan Fuhs. 100-

Chuck, an English male owned and handled by Jim Rifanburg. 150+

Poodle, an English male owned and handled by Grant Tuttle, 0

The results were split for $500 to each cast winner.
